The Sony VPL-PHZ50 is a powerful 5,000-lumen laser projector that excels in delivering bright and vivid images, making it ideal for both home cinema and business presentations. With a high resolution of 1920 x 1200 (WUXGA), it offers sharp and detailed pictures, which is great for viewing movies, presentations, or any high-definition content. The projector's contrast ratio and 'Infinite Black' technology contribute to deep blacks and excellent color gradation, enhancing the viewing experience.
The adjustable throw distance (1.23:1 to 1.97:1) offers flexibility in setup, allowing it to be used in various room sizes. Additionally, the vertical lens shift feature (-35% to +55%) makes it easier to position the projector without distorting the image. Connectivity is well-covered with USB and HDMI ports, ensuring compatibility with multiple devices.
One of the standout features is its laser light source, which provides a longer lamp life compared to traditional projectors, reducing maintenance needs. However, the projector's portability might be limited due to its size and weight, making it less convenient for frequent transportation. In summary, the Sony VPL-PHZ50 is a robust choice for users seeking a high-lumen projector with excellent image quality and versatile connectivity options, though it's best suited for more permanent installations rather than on-the-go use.
The Panasonic PT-VMZ61 is a bright projector with 6200 lumens, making it a strong choice for environments that need clear images even in well-lit rooms, such as classrooms or conference halls. Its WUXGA resolution (1920 x 1200) provides sharp and detailed images, which is slightly better than standard Full HD, so text and visuals look clear. It uses LCD laser technology, which tends to have good color accuracy and longer lamp life compared to traditional projectors.
The built-in speaker adds convenience for basic audio needs, but for better sound quality, external speakers might still be preferred. Connectivity-wise, it offers HDMI, which is common and compatible with most devices. The projector is relatively heavy at 20.5 pounds and has moderate size, so it’s more suited for fixed installations rather than frequent portability.
With its brightness and resolution, this model is well-suited for educational or professional settings where bright, clear projection is essential. It may not be the best option for those seeking a projector primarily for very dark room movie watching or easy portability.
The Sony BRAVIA Projector 7 is a strong choice for those seeking a bright, high-quality home theater projector. With up to 2,200 lumens from a long-lasting laser light source, it delivers vibrant and clear images suitable for larger screens and well-lit rooms. Its native 4K resolution (3840 x 2160 pixels) ensures sharp visuals, while the XR processing technology and TRILUMINOS PRO color system bring out a wide range of natural colors for a rich viewing experience. The projector’s contrast and color reproduction benefit from Wide Dynamic Range Optics, giving you deep blacks and bright colors simultaneously.
This model also supports smooth motion with low input lag, making it friendly for watching fast-paced 4K content or gaming. At 2,200 lumens, it’s bright for most home uses but may not compete with some ultra-high-lumen projectors meant for very large or brightly lit spaces. Connectivity is straightforward with HDMI, suitable for most modern devices.
The Sony BRAVIA Projector 7 stands out as a premium, reliable projector that excels in picture quality and color, making it especially well-suited for home cinema enthusiasts who value 4K detail and vivid colors in moderately lit environments.
